Xano vs. Supabase: Choosing the Right Backend Solution for Your No-Code Development Needs
Overview of Xano and Supabase
Xano and Supabase are both prominent backend solutions designed to simplify application development. They cater to different needs within the realm of no-code and low-code development. Selecting the right platform can significantly impact the efficiency and effectiveness of an application, especially for developers looking to minimize coding requirements. Drive Phase Consulting emphasizes the importance of leveraging no-code technologies to streamline project workflows, making it easier for businesses to innovate and reduce costs.
Both platforms are designed to support integrations with various frontend frameworks, enhancing their overall usability in app development. Xano adopts a no-code-first approach, which is particularly advantageous for users with minimal coding experience, enabling them to build robust backends without diving deeply into programming. On the other hand, Supabase is perceived as more straightforward for beginners, making it an attractive choice for those with limited coding knowledge.
Key Features of Xano
Xano is renowned for providing a comprehensive no-code backend solution that encompasses a database, server functionalities, and an API builder all in one platform. This all-in-one approach allows users to create complex applications without extensive coding knowledge. One of the standout features of Xano is its support for enterprise-level scalability, which includes functionalities like branching, merging, and compliance with ISO 27001 standards. This makes it a preferred choice for organizations that require robust and secure backend solutions.
Moreover, Xano offers advanced capabilities such as real-time collaboration, allowing multiple users to work on business logic simultaneously, enhancing team productivity. Its fixed pricing model provides clarity and predictability for budgeting, which can be particularly beneficial for businesses planning their expenditures. Additionally, Xano facilitates intricate data relationships and workflows, making it suitable for applications with complex backend requirements, such as a project management tool that needs to link multiple data sources effectively.
Key Features of Supabase
Supabase serves as an open-source alternative to Firebase, focusing primarily on database management and real-time capabilities. It provides a rich set of features, including real-time updates, which is essential for applications requiring live data interactions, such as chat applications or collaborative tools. Supabase's free tier allows developers to build small applications without incurring costs, which can be particularly appealing for startups or individuals experimenting with new ideas.
However, Supabase does require some coding knowledge for implementing custom business logic and APIs, which may limit its accessibility for non-technical users. Its extensible functions, such as PostgreSQL functions and Edge Functions, cater to more advanced users who want greater control over their applications. Supabase also supports multiple database types, giving developers the flexibility to choose the best data structure for their specific application needs, such as a relational database for an e-commerce platform or a NoSQL option for a content management system.
Pricing Models Comparison
When comparing the pricing models, Xano's plans begin around $99 per month, which can be a significant investment for startups and small businesses. This pricing encompasses a comprehensive suite of features, including dedicated support, which can justify the cost for larger enterprises that require extensive backend capabilities. In contrast, Supabase offers a more economical entry point, starting at $25 per month, which appeals to budget-conscious developers.
Supabase's pricing structure is usage-based, which can lead to unexpected costs as applications scale, making it crucial for developers to monitor their usage closely. Additionally, the open-source nature of Supabase allows for self-hosting, potentially reducing long-term costs for users who have the technical expertise to manage their infrastructure. This flexibility may be a deciding factor for developers aiming for cost-effective solutions over time, especially for projects that anticipate significant growth.
Use Cases for Xano
Xano is particularly well-suited for users who prefer a no-code development environment, allowing them to create complex APIs and backends without extensive coding knowledge. It's ideal for enterprise applications that demand robust backend solutions with high compliance and security standards. For example, a healthcare application that requires stringent data protection measures would benefit from Xano's ISO compliance features.
Moreover, Xano is commonly utilized in scenarios that require real-time data collaboration, such as project management tools where team members need to access and modify data simultaneously. It is also beneficial for startups looking for quick go-to-market solutions without the burden of backend infrastructure management, as it provides a fully managed backend environment.
Use Cases for Supabase
Supabase shines in projects that require real-time data handling and authentication features, making it an excellent choice for applications like live chat systems or collaborative platforms. Developers who appreciate the flexibility of an open-source solution often favor Supabase, especially if they are building applications that can leverage PostgreSQL's strengths.
It's particularly effective for small to medium-sized applications that can benefit from a cost-effective backend solution. For instance, a small e-commerce platform might utilize Supabase for its product database while taking advantage of real-time features to update inventory levels dynamically. Additionally, Supabase's ease of use and free tier offerings make it a popular choice for educational projects and hackathons, where quick setups and low costs are essential.
Summary and Recommendations
In summary, both Xano and Supabase present unique strengths and weaknesses in the realm of backend development. Xano is ideal for users seeking no-code solutions with robust enterprise features, while Supabase appeals to those who prefer an open-source framework with real-time capabilities. It is essential for developers to analyze their specific project needs when choosing between the two platforms.
For businesses looking to leverage no-code technologies effectively, Drive Phase Consulting can provide guidance and support throughout the development process. To learn more about how to streamline your development and maximize the potential of no-code solutions, visit Drive Phase Consulting.
Featured Blog Posts
Read some of our latest blog posts
Accelerating MVP Iteration: The Value of No-Code Development
Accelerate MVP iteration with no-code tools for rapid development, collaboration, and market entry.
How Seagate's Lyve Team Saved $2.3 Million and Accelerated Development by Switching from Full Code to Bubble.io
In the world of enterprise technology, innovation often hinges on balancing speed, cost, and functionality. Seagate's Lyve team recently demonstrated the transformative potential of no-code solutions by switching from a traditional full-code development process to Bubble.io. This decision resulted in staggering savings—$2.3 million annually by eliminating outsourced coding contracts—and significantly reduced project timelines from 15 months to just 3–4 months.
Why Wireframes are Essential for Custom App Development Success
Discover why wireframes are essential for successful custom app development, improving communication, saving time, and enhancing user experience.
Unlocking the Power of No-Code: Can It Really Meet Your Needs or Are There Hidden Limitations?
Explore the benefits and limitations of no-code platforms to determine if they can truly meet your development needs.
Debunking the Myths: Why Vendor Lock-in in No-Code Platforms is Overstated
Explore the reality behind vendor lock-in risks in no-code platforms and discover how businesses can navigate these concerns effectively.
Validating Your Startup Idea: Why You Should Do It Quickly and Cheaply
Validating your startup idea is crucial to ensure you're solving a problem that people will pay to solve. As a founder, it's important to validate your idea quickly and cheaply before fully developing a product. You can start by offering your solution as a consulting service or using existing tools to create a minimum viable version. The most important step in validation is not just asking people if they would buy but actually getting them to pay. This shows genuine interest and proves your idea addresses a real, painful problem. By validating early, you save time, money, and increase your chances of building a successful product.
HIPAA Compliant App Development Using No Code
No code development represents a transformative shift in how applications are built. This approach is particularly significant given the healthcare industry's strict regulations, such as HIPAA (Health Insurance Portability and Accountability Act), which governs the privacy and security of medical information. The issue has historically been that many no code platforms are not HIPAA compliant. However, two of the new paltforms, WeWeb and Xano, are actually HIPAA compliant which opens up the benefits of no code to more health care organizations.
The Importance of Valuing Time for Small Business Owners
Small business owners often face a unique challenge of valuing their own time. Juggling numerous responsibilities, they can easily fall into the trap of undervaluing their hours, leading to burnout, procrastination, and stunted business growth. This struggle is often rooted in the complexity of roles they play – from sales to marketing to operations – which often leaves little time for strategic thinking and planning.
Our Lead No-Code Consultant Becomes One of the First 100 Certified Bubble Developers
We are excited to announce that our very own Lead No-Code Consultant, Xan Hong, has achieved a significant milestone by becoming one of the first 100 Certified Bubble Developers through Bubble.io. This accomplishment not only underscores Xan's commitment to staying at the forefront of technological innovation but also reinforces Drive Phase Consulting's dedication to providing top-tier, cutting-edge solutions to our clients as a Bubble Consultant.
How We Saved This E-Commerce Site Close to 1,000 Hours Per Year
During the pandemic, people were scrambling for interesting activities to do while being cooped up in quarantine. One such activity that a lot of people turned to was paint by numbers. One website, Just Paint by Number, saw their revenue grow over 1,100% during the pandemic. While a good problem to have, it's still a problem to handle such astronomical growth if you're not prepared for it. We helped turn this business into a valuable passive income stream for it's owner through a combination of building a custom no code automation application and outsourcing.